Beste Sitedealers,
Ik ben absoluut geen ster in programmeren. Sterker nog ik muteer bestaande scripts en dat lukt me aardig. Goed kijken en lezen.
Echter nu kom ik er echt niet uit. Het gaat om het volgende:
Ik wil op de voorpagina van mijn website headlines tonen, laten we zeggen een stuk of 20
Nu zijn er bijvoorbeeld gisteren (1 februari) 5 headlines geplaatst en vandaag staan er bijvoorbeeld al weer 3 headlines. Als je niets bijzonders uithaald met het oproepen van de headlines dan staan ze allemaal op volgorde van sorteren onder elkaar.
Ik wil de headlines per dag laten zien.
Dan ziet het er dus bijvoorbeeld als volgt uit:
2 Februari
headline 30
headline 29
headline 28
1 Februari
headline 27
headline 26
headline 25
headline 24
headline 23
Dit in plaats van
headline 30
headline 29
headline 28
headline 27
headline 26
headline 25
headline 24
headline 23
Hoe krijg ik dat met php en mysql voor elkaar
Ook een gerichte zoekopdracht in Google is al welkom. Ik weet namelijk niet waar ik op moet zoeken ;-)
Alvast bedankt voor de genomen moeite
Gr. Rich
- PHP/MySQL vraag Headlines sorteren per datum
-
02-02-2011, 07:45 #1
- Berichten
- 1.367
- Lid sinds
- 16 Jaar
PHP/MySQL vraag Headlines sorteren per datum
-
In de schijnwerper
Product feed grid V1.7 - Creer een affiliate shop in 2 min - WP plugin - V1.7 NU LIVEPHP scriptsVerhoog je Autoriteit met Blogs en BacklinksLinkpartnersSEO-tekstschrijver inhuren | beter vindbaar met webtekstenFreelance / WerkBacklinks.nl - Groot assortiment | Bekijk NR. 1 voorbeelden <---Advertentieruimte -
02-02-2011, 08:17 #2
- Berichten
- 943
- Lid sinds
- 15 Jaar
Re: PHP/MySQL vraag Headlines sorteren per datum
Ik weet niet precies hoe de datum in de database wordt gezet, maar je zou het zo kunnen doen:
PHP Code:<?php
mysql_query("SELECT * FROM headlines ORDER BY datum DESC");
?>
Gr.
Jos
-
02-02-2011, 08:22 #3
- Berichten
- 169
- Lid sinds
- 15 Jaar
Re: PHP/MySQL vraag Headlines sorteren per datum
@Jos van M je ziet toch zelf ook wel dat dat niet is wat hij wilt.. Hij wilt per dag een rijtje hebben, en de rijen per dag gescheiden.. ik zelf wilde zoiets eerst ook en ben er toen ook niet helemaal uitgekomen. Ik hou dit topic in de gaten en als ik meer weet zal ik het hier posten.
-
02-02-2011, 09:11 #4
- Berichten
- 91
- Lid sinds
- 18 Jaar
Re: PHP/MySQL vraag Headlines sorteren per datum
- Edit: sorry verkeerd begrepen
-
02-02-2011, 09:14 #5
- Berichten
- 1.367
- Lid sinds
- 16 Jaar
Re: PHP/MySQL vraag Headlines sorteren per datum
Jep, klopt. Op de voorpagina per datum gescheiden. Lijkt makkelijker dan het is. :-)
-
02-02-2011, 09:27 #6
- Berichten
- 91
- Lid sinds
- 18 Jaar
Re: PHP/MySQL vraag Headlines sorteren per datum
Bedoel je zo iets?
Het is niet optimaal maar het gaat om het idee.
PHP Code:$result = mysql_query("SELECT *, DATE_FORMAT(date, '%e %M') as day FROM headlines");
$oldDay = '';
echo "<table>";
while ($row = mysql_fetch_assoc($result)) {
{
if($oldDay!=$row['day'])
{
echo '<tr>';
echo '<td>' . $row['day'] . '</td>';
echo '</tr>';
$oldDay = $row['day'];
}
echo '<tr>';
echo '<td>' . $row['headline'] . '</td>';
echo '</tr>';
}
echo "</table>";
-
02-02-2011, 09:28 #7
- Berichten
- 59
- Lid sinds
- 16 Jaar
Re: PHP/MySQL vraag Headlines sorteren per datum
Ik zou in dit geval de datum PER DAG groeperen met bv MySQL 'day()' functie..
http://dev.mysql.com/doc/refman/5.5/...l#function_day
Code:"SELECT id, titel, tekst, DAY(datum) AS dag FROM headlines ORDER BY datum DESC LIMIT 15" $curDay=0; while($r=...){ if($r['dag']!=$curDay){ //NIEUWE DAG, doe iets.. $curDay = $r['dag']; } //$r }
-
02-02-2011, 09:31 #8
- Berichten
- 1.367
- Lid sinds
- 16 Jaar
Re: PHP/MySQL vraag Headlines sorteren per datum
Iedereen tot zover bedankt, ik ga aan de slag met de verkregen info. Laat later weten hoe het is geworden.
Gr. Rich
Plaats een
- + Advertentie
- + Onderwerp
Marktplaats
Webmasterforum
- Websites algemeen
- Sitechecks
- Marketing
- Domeinen algemeen
- Waardebepaling
- CMS
- Wordpress
- Joomla
- Magento
- Google algemeen
- SEO
- Analytics
- Adsense
- Adwords
- HTML / XHTML
- CSS
- Programmeren
- PHP
- Javascript
- JQuery
- MySQL
- Ondernemen algemeen
- Belastingen
- Juridisch
- Grafisch ontwerp
- Hosting Algemeen
- Hardware Info
- Offtopic